Hardy, long-lived, and dependable once established, Setsugekka offers extended seasonal interest with minimal maintenance.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r data-start=\"986\" data-end=\"991\"\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"993\" data-end=\"1038\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-start=\"993\" data-end=\"1036\"\u003eWhy You'll Love the Setsugekka Camellia\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"1040\" data-end=\"1193\"\u003eBrilliant White Blooms: Large semi-double white flowers with golden centers bloom from fall into early winter, bringing elegant color to the landscape.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"1195\" data-end=\"1310\"\u003eYear-Round Evergreen Structure: Glossy dark green foliage maintains structure and beauty throughout every season.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"1312\" data-end=\"1467\"\u003eImpressive Mature Size: Growing 8 to 12 feet tall and 6 to 8 feet wide at maturity, it works beautifully as a flowering hedge, screen, or specimen plant.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"1469\" data-end=\"1616\"\u003eExcellent Fall Bloomer: Unlike many camellias that bloom in late winter, Setsugekka begins flowering in fall, extending seasonal garden interest.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r data-start=\"1618\" data-end=\"1623\"\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"1625\" data-end=\"1658\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-start=\"1625\" data-end=\"1656\"\u003eSetsugekka Camellia Details\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"1660\" data-end=\"2091\"\u003eBotanical Name: Camellia sasanqua 'Setsugekka'\u003cbr data-start=\"1706\" data-end=\"1709\"\u003eType: Evergreen flowering shrub\u003cbr data-start=\"1740\" data-end=\"1743\"\u003eMature Size: 96-144\" tall × 72-96\" wide (upright spreading habit)\u003cbr data-start=\"1808\" data-end=\"1811\"\u003eGrowth Rate: Moderate growth rate\u003cbr data-start=\"1844\" data-end=\"1847\"\u003eLight: Partial shade to filtered sun (tolerates more sun than japonica varieties)\u003cbr data-start=\"1928\" data-end=\"1931\"\u003eSoil: Well-drained, acidic soil rich in organic matter\u003cbr data-start=\"1985\" data-end=\"1988\"\u003eWater: Water regularly until established, prefers consistent moisture\u003cbr data-start=\"2057\" data-end=\"2060\"\u003eUSDA Hardiness Zones: 7, 8, 9\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r data-start=\"2093\" data-end=\"2098\"\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"2100\" data-end=\"2124\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-start=\"2100\" data-end=\"2122\"\u003eGrowing Conditions\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"2126\" data-end=\"2274\"\u003eSoil Adaptability: Performs best in evenly moist, well-drained acidic soil enriched with organic matter. Avoid poorly drained or heavy clay soils.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"2276\" data-end=\"2440\"\u003eLight Requirements: Thrives in partial shade to filtered sun and tolerates more direct sunlight than many other camellia varieties, especially in cooler climates.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"2442\" data-end=\"2561\"\u003eHardiness: USDA zones 7-9, making it ideal for southern and mild temperate regions with protection from extreme cold.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r data-start=\"2563\" data-end=\"2568\"\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"2570\" data-end=\"2593\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-start=\"2570\" data-end=\"2591\"\u003eCare Instructions\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"2595\" data-end=\"2752\"\u003eWatering: Water regularly during the first growing season to establish a deep root system. Maintain consistent moisture, particularly during bud formation.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"2754\" data-end=\"2890\"\u003ePruning: Prune lightly after flowering if needed to shape or control size. Responds well to selective pruning for hedge or screen use.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"2892\" data-end=\"3051\"\u003eFertilizing: Apply a fertilizer formulated for camellias or acid-loving plants in spring after blooming to promote healthy growth and future bud development.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r data-start=\"3053\" data-end=\"3058\"\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"3060\" data-end=\"3082\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-start=\"3060\" data-end=\"3080\"\u003eLandscaping Uses\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"3084\" data-end=\"3282\"\u003eVersatile Applications: Setsugekka Camellia’s upright habit and fall blooms make it suitable for: flowering hedges, privacy screens, foundation plantings, woodland gardens, and specimen plantings.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"3284\" data-end=\"3457\"\u003eScreen \u0026amp; Hedge Excellence: Its taller mature size and dense evergreen foliage make it an excellent choice for creating natural privacy screens or elegant flowering hedges.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003chr data-start=\"3459\" data-end=\"3464\"\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"3466\" data-end=\"3498\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-start=\"3466\" data-end=\"3496\"\u003eFrequently Asked Questions\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"3500\" data-end=\"3663\"\u003eHow far apart should I plant Setsugekka Camellia? For hedges or screens, plant 6 to 8 feet apart on center to allow for mature growth and proper air circulation.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"3665\" data-end=\"3797\"\u003eWhen does Setsugekka Camellia bloom? It typically blooms from fall into early winter, depending on climate and growing conditions.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"3799\" data-end=\"3946\" data-is-last-node=\"\" data-is-only-node=\"\"\u003eIs Setsugekka Camellia evergreen? Yes, it maintains its glossy green foliage year round, providing consistent structure and beauty in every season.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"TreesAndPlants.com","offers":[{"title":"3-Gallon","offer_id":48343678386391,"sku":"0098","price":40.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true},{"title":"7-Gallon","offer_id":48343678419159,"sku":"0099","price":65.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0771\/5592\/6231\/files\/Setsugekka_Camellia_in_Landscaping.png?v=1772575794","url":"https:\/\/www.treesandplants.com\/products\/setsugekka-camellia-3-gallon-and-7-gallon","provider":"Trees and Plants","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
